Transaction 00183b87c6b5ddb308a206d26a2d134423808fea80781f8f028c546c82d38ea9
1 Input
1 Output
-
00183b87c6b5ddb308a206d26a2d134423808fea80781f8f028c546c82d38ea9: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ccf72bf381626cdffeb9c9b4c73d600ae36ac2bef129d6cb2391039e7c77afa6
- address
- bc1penmjhuupvfkdll4eex6vw0tqpt3k4s477y5adjerjypeulrh47nq3wg50g